Stechlin, a region in northern Brandenburg, Germany, is characterized by its extensive forests and numerous lakes, forming the core of the Stechlin-Ruppiner Land Nature Park. The landscape features ancient beech groves, over 160 lakes, and small marshes, providing a diverse natural environment. Lake Stechlin itself is known as Brandenburg's deepest and one of Germany's clearest lakes, surrounded by well-preserved natural areas. This varied terrain makes Stechlin suitable for several sports like hiking, touring cycling, jogging, road cycling, and more.

Lake Stechlin (Großer Stechlinsee) is known as the deepest lake in Brandenburg and one of Germany's clearest, with visibility often reaching 26-33 feet (8-10 meters). It is an oligotrophic lake, supporting unique aquatic life like the endemic Fontane cisco, and is surrounded by ancient forests.

The Stechlin region is home to diverse wildlife, including rare species such as otters, Elbe beavers, European pond turtles, and agile frogs. Birdwatchers may spot ospreys, cranes, and kingfishers, while the ancient forests provide habitat for rare beetles and seven types of woodpeckers.

The Stechlin-Ruppiner Land Nature Park is characterized by its extensive forests and numerous lakes. It encompasses over 160 lakes, small marshes, and significant old deciduous forests, primarily beech groves. Lake Stechlin, the deepest and clearest lake in Brandenburg, is a central feature.

The Ruppiner Land Circular Trail is a long-distance route in the region, posing a challenge for keen hikers. This trail spans approximately 155 miles (250 kilometers), offering an extensive way to explore the diverse landscapes of the Stechlin-Ruppiner Land Nature Park.
